虚拟化技术正在以惊人的速度改变着IT行业的面貌,特别是在操作系统的使用和管理方面。借助虚拟化,企业能够更有效地利用硬件资源、提高工作效率,并降低成本。它不仅重新定义了基础架构的部署方式,还赋予IT专业人员更多的灵活性与控制力。

随着市场上对云计算的不断依赖,虚拟化技术成为了提高数据中心效率的关键。在这一领域,最新的性能评测显示,采用虚拟化技术的系统,其资源利用率通常比传统物理服务器高出50%以上。这意味着同样配置的硬件能支撑更多的虚拟机(VM),从而节省了设备采购和电力消耗等相关开支。
在可预见的未来,虚拟化还将推动反向技术的创新。诸如容器化技术(例如Docker和Kubernetes)在操作系统的虚拟化层之上提供了无缝的工作流。它们允许开发者在多种环境中轻松部署和管理应用程序,使得CI/CD(持续集成和持续交付)流程的大幅优化成为可能。这种灵活性令运维团队能够在短时间内交付高质量的服务。
除了提升性能,虚拟化还为IT专业人员带来了DIY组装和性能优化的新机遇。用户可以根据需要灵活选择合适的虚拟化软件和操作系统,进行个性化的系统配置。例如,对于希望提高数据库性能的开发者,利用虚拟化可以快速建立多个测试环境,且这些环境之间互不干扰,有助于进行真实的性能比较。
在硬件选型方面,使用支持虚拟化的处理器(如Intel VT-x或AMD-V)至关重要。适当的内存及存储配置更是决定虚拟化性能的关键。结合SSD以提高数据的读写速度,可显著减少虚拟机的加载时间和响应延迟。
在虚拟化的过程中,也不可忽视安全问题。随着虚拟化技术的普及,攻击者也逐渐瞄准虚拟环境。为此,采用良好的安全策略与常规的安全更新措施不可或缺。通过建立多层次的安全防护体系,能够有效降低虚拟化环境中的风险。
在实际应用中,各大云服务平台(如AWS、Azure、Google Cloud)均采用了虚拟化技术,这不仅使其能够快速扩展资源,也为客户提供了灵活的付费模式,以按需计费的方式降低了使用成本。这种趋势在企业数字化转型中显得尤为重要。
这种结合趋势将会持续影响各行各业的工作方式,未来的职场有望成为一个更加灵活、智能化的环境。大幅度的时间节省和资源优化,必将使团队能够集中精力在创新和更具战略性的任务上。
常见问题解答
1. 虚拟化技术对操作系统的影响是什么?
虚拟化技术使得操作系统能够在同一硬件上运行多个虚拟机,从而提升资源利用率和灵活性。
2. 如何选择适合自己需求的虚拟化软件?
选择时需考虑性能需求、用户友好性、社区支持、价格及功能特性等因素。
3. 虚拟化和容器化有什么区别?
虚拟化通过在物理硬件上运行多个操作系统实例,而容器化则是在操作系统层面上运行多个隔离的应用程序,效率更高。
4. 在使用虚拟化时,如何优化系统性能?
可以通过增加内存、选择SSD存储、合理分配CPU资源和定期监测系统性能来实现。
5. 虚拟化技术会影响系统的安全性吗?
会的,虚拟化环境中同样存在安全风险,因此需要采取额外的安全防护措施,比如防火墙和定期更新。